Compare hotforex vs OptionWeb Commission And Fees
hotforex and OptionWeb are online broker platforms, and most online brokerages charge lower fees than traditional brokerages tend to charge. The cause of this is that the businesses of online brokerages are scaled much better. That is, an online broker is not necessarily affected by the amount of clients they have.
But this does not necessarily mean that online brokers do not charge any fees. They charge prices of varying rates for a variety of services to earn money. There are primarily 3 types of fees for this purpose.
The first sort of charges to keep an eye out for are trading fees. Whenever you make a genuine trade, like buying a stock or an ETF, you're billed trading charges. In such instances, you're paying a spread, funding speed, or even a commission. The sorts of trading fees and the rates vary from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or dependent on the traded volume. On the flip side, a spread denotes the difference between the buying and selling price. Financing or overnight prices are those that are billed when you maintain a leveraged position for longer than a day.
Aside from trading charges, online agents also bill non-trading fees. These are determined by the activities you undertake on your accounts. They're charged for surgeries like depositing cash, not investing for lengthy periods, or withdrawals.
